H4

In the context of histones and DNA epigenetics, "H4" refers to a specific type of histone protein known as Histone 4. Histones are a group of proteins that play a central role in packaging and organizing DNA within the nucleus of a cell. They are involved in forming the basic repeating unit of chromatin, known as a nucleosome, which helps compact DNA and regulate gene expression.
